Mental Health Services in El Paso, Texas

El Paso, Texas, a vibrant city with over 680,000 residents, is known for its rich blend of cultures, natural beauty, and proximity to the Franklin Mountains. Despite being a bustling border town, the need for mental health services is just as critical here.

Key Mental-Health Concerns for El Paso Residents

Common mental health conditions in El Paso include depression, anxiety, and post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D). According to the CDC, Texas has a higher than average prevalence of mental health conditions.

Access to Care & Providers in El Paso

El Paso offers a robust network of public and private mental health services. Resources include crisis lines, community organizations like Emergence Health Network, and local initiatives aimed at increasing access to mental health treatment.

Therapies & Specialties

  • El Paso therapists commonly offer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) to help manage mental health conditions.
  • EMDR and other trauma-focused care are readily available for individuals dealing with PTSD or other trauma-related disorders.
  • Unique local offerings include bilingual care, e-therapy, and support for veterans.

Local Policies & Stressors

Local stressors such as the cost of living, industry pressures, and the challenges faced by the large student population can contribute to mental health issues. Additionally, the city's unique position as a border town can lead to unique stressors and mental health needs.
